Yeah,they orientation there. The people aren't bad, but you won't get a warm fuzzy feeling, at least not till after you are actually hired. They just see too many people go through to get friendly. And even then, it won't feel like family
Breakfast and dinner are your responsibility, but they will feed you lunch. When the give you the menu to select lunch, each item has 2 prices. Lower is just the sandwich, so pick the higher priced item, it comes with fries and a side. They will provide sweat tea, but for anything elsa, you'll have to get it at the vending machines.
Greer is not bad, nicer than Gary and more pleasant than Phoenix. -
